SMEDC Launches Preliminary Questionnaire for the First Syrian Entrepreneurs Competition
The Small and Medium Enterprises Development Commission (SMEDC) announced the start of preparations to launch the "First Syrian Entrepreneurs Competition." It has issued a public invitation to all entrepreneurs and owners of pioneering and innovative projects in the Syrian Arab Republic to register via a dedicated questionnaire link.
This questionnaire primarily aims to characterize entrepreneurial projects, study their needs, enhance effective communication, and link them with the commission and its various programs.
Objectives of Registering in the Questionnaire
Building an integrated database for entrepreneurial and innovative projects in Syria.
Enhancing continuous communication channels between entrepreneurs and the commission.
Providing opportunities to join the commission's future platforms and programs.
Supporting and developing projects by linking them to training, empowerment, and networking opportunities.
Information Confidentiality and Security
In an important note, the commission emphasized its full commitment to maintaining the confidentiality of the information provided in the questionnaire. It also stressed that all intellectual property rights, projects, and ideas submitted remain reserved for their owners and cannot be used or shared without the prior consent of the stakeholders.
